基于CS5532的水分测定仪称重模块设计

摘    要:物质的水分含量是决定物质物理、化学、生物特性的重要指标,其准确测定具有重要意义。现有的水分测定仪称重结果的测量精度和实时性往往难以同时满足要求。为此,设计了一种基于CS5532的水分测定仪称重模块,阐述了称重传感器的工作原理,给出了称重模块的硬件电路设计,并详细描述了称重数据的预处理策略及其实现方法。实验结果表明:基于该模块的水分测定仪测定结果响应快、实时性好,称重精度为1 mg,水分测量误差不大于0.1%,响应时间小于0.4 s,稳定时间不大于5 s。

Design of weighing module of moisture analyzer based on CS5532

Abstract:The moisture content of substance is an important indicator to determine the physical,chemical and biological characteristics of the substance,and accurate measurement of moisture content has important significance.The exist moisture analyzer cannot satisfy the precision of measurement and the real-time performance of weighing simultaneously.A weighing module of moisture analyzer based on CS5532 is designed and the working principle of weighing module is discussed,and the hardware circuit design is described in detail.The experimental results show that the moisture analyzer based on this designed module has quick response of test result and well real-time performance with precision of 0.1mg.The moisture measurement error is less than 0.1%,the response time is less than 0.4s and the stabilization time is less than 5s.
